UPVC Window Handle Replacement

Replacing a broken window handle is a relatively easy process, and with the right tools it can be done quickly. However, it is essential to know the handle's type and spindle's length prior to purchasing a replacement window Pane.

Older uPVC windows have cockspur handles for windows. They have an extension spur that can the lock of a wedge cockspur striker plate. These can be right-handed or left-handed and must match when replaced.

Inline Espagnolette Handles

These are the most commonly used type of upvc handles and are usually placed on the outside of your window. They are flat and feature an opening that engages the locking mechanism of the window frame. Inline upvc handles also have spindles that run through the center of the handle and then into the frame of the window to operate the latch.

Cockspur Handles

These handles are typically found on older uPVC windows and have distinct hook-shaped designs. Cockspur handles have a single screw that secures the handle to the window frame and are not as secure as other kinds of window replacement cost uk handles.

Handles that can tilt and turn

Unlike the other upvc handles that are tilt and turn, these handles can be turned to open the window, and the handle can be tilted to the side for ventilation. They have a 7mm spindle on the back and are available both in left and right-handed versions.

How do I get rid of the handle from the previous one?

Through time and regular use, window handles can become damaged or broken and if this happens it is crucial to repair them as soon as you can to ensure the security of your home. The good news is that replacing a damaged or worn handle is a relatively easy task that can be accomplished in less than one minute and doesn't require any special tools.

To remove the handle, you must first remove the screw at the bottom of the handle. Once the screw has been removed, the handle can be pulled away. There is another screw located at the bottom of the handle base, and it can be removed too. After these two screws are removed, the handle can be detached from the window's base.

After removing the handle and align the fixing holes of the new handle to the holes already present in the window frame. There may be a little cap or sticker on the new handle, so take off them if needed and then put the handle in its place. It is important to check that the handle works once it is put in place. Turn the handle around and make sure that the lock mechanism is working.

Espag handles come with spindles that protrude out of the handle and slots into the multipoint locking mechanism on the frame of the window. Cadenza windows have an edge with cut-outs which slot into the lock mechanism while Cockspur handles have an extended nose that hangs over either the frame's outer or the transom bar cross member inside the window.

Once you have the new handle in place, insert the spindle into the lock in the window and then tighten it. Once the handle is firmly fixated, replace the'snap in' cover and the screw cap (if appropriate). Now that the handle is in use, simply open and close the window a few times to ensure it works properly and securely.

Replacement-Windows-150x150.jpgHow do I put in the new handle?

It's not difficult to alter the handle on your windows made of uPVC. The process is very simple. All you require is a screwdriver, and a small amount of patience. First, make sure that the handle that you are replacing is unlocked. Then remove any screws that are visible. You could also replace them with screw caps. Once the handle is removed it is necessary to take a note of the length of the spindle which protrudes from the back of the handle. This is crucial since it will determine the kind of handle you'll need to buy.

Espagnolette handles made of uPVC are the most sought-after kind of handle. The spindle is inserted into the handle to operate the locking mechanism inside the window frame. The handle releases the latch and allows the window to open. In regular use and over time, espagnolette handles may become damaged.

Cadenza handles are a second type of uPVC window handle commonly used on tilt and turn windows. They have a protruding blade that operates a multipoint locking mechanism within the window. They are generally more secure than handles made of espagnolette because they can only be opened from the inside. They can be replaced using the same method as you would with espagnolette handles however, make sure that the new handle is not angled and flat.

Once you have determined the right handle to purchase then you can align the new handle with the existing screw holes, and then screw it into place. Then, you should put the screws on and test the new handle. This is done by shifting the handle from the locked position to the unlocked and then back to the locked position a few times.
